EU Council President Expresses Solidarity with GCC States Against Attacks

European Council President Antonio Costa expressed the European Union's full solidarity with Gulf Cooperation Council member states against ongoing attacks, following a phone call with UAE President Sheikh Mohammed bin Zayed Al Nahyan on Sunday.

Costa confirmed that the EU stands firmly alongside the GCC nations during this critical period, emphasizing the importance of the longstanding partnership between Europe and the Gulf region. The conversation between the two leaders addressed the latest security developments affecting Gulf states and the need for a coordinated international response.

The European Council president's remarks come amid heightened tensions in the region, with GCC member states facing security threats that have drawn international concern and condemnation. The phone call with Sheikh Mohammed bin Zayed underscored the strategic nature of the EU-Gulf relationship, which spans trade, energy, security cooperation, and diplomatic coordination on global affairs.

Costa reaffirmed that any attacks targeting sovereign nations in the Gulf region are unacceptable under international law, signaling that Brussels views the security of GCC states as directly linked to European strategic interests. The EU and the GCC signed a comprehensive cooperation agreement in recent years, deepening ties across multiple sectors and establishing mechanisms for regular political dialogue.

The solidarity expressed by the EU carries particular significance for Qatar and its fellow GCC members, as the bloc represents one of the Gulf's largest trading partners and a key diplomatic interlocutor on the world stage. Qatar has consistently advocated for multilateral approaches to regional security and has maintained strong bilateral relations with major EU member states, including France, Germany, and Italy.

Doha's diplomatic engagements with European capitals have intensified in recent years, with Qatar playing a central role in energy security discussions following shifts in global supply chains. The emirate's position as one of the world's leading exporters of liquefied natural gas has made it an indispensable partner for European nations seeking to diversify their energy sources.

The phone call between Costa and Sheikh Mohammed bin Zayed also touched on broader regional stability, with both leaders agreeing on the necessity of dialogue and de-escalation as the primary tools for resolving disputes. The UAE president briefed his European counterpart on the Gulf perspective regarding the security situation and the measures being taken to protect civilian populations and critical infrastructure.

Diplomatic observers noted that the EU's explicit expression of solidarity represents a strengthening of the transregional security framework that has been developing between Europe and the Gulf. The statement is expected to be followed by further consultations at the ministerial level between EU foreign policy officials and their GCC counterparts in the coming days.
